Transaction 70f2fcee34ed0cce1ffd6d521404061724f35e1a6dd910376d96fc4bad829203
3 Input
2 Outputs
- 70f2fcee34ed0cce1ffd6d521404061724f35e1a6dd910376d96fc4bad829203:0
- 70f2fcee34ed0cce1ffd6d521404061724f35e1a6dd910376d96fc4bad829203:1
value 445186
address 3HC2gjoXDsbvnZrh6siViKm76mt2cYhdrD
value 277467
address 1MMtXk59eyt7UpG6nRwcJRYhu2DBXABT8J